Faceting
Clicking a value in one chart — say, a region on a bar chart — facets every other connected widget on the page to that selection. Click again to clear it. This is the default interaction in CRM Analytics and needs no configuration.
Explicit filters
Filter widgets (dropdowns, date pickers, toggles) let a viewer set a condition without needing a chart to click on — useful for fields that aren't already charted, like "Fiscal Quarter."
Drilling down
Some charts support drill paths — clicking a bar in "Region" reveals the next level, like "Country," without leaving the chart. Drill paths are configured by the dashboard builder ahead of time.
Clearing selections
A Clear or Reset filters action (often in the top toolbar) removes all facets and filters at once, returning the dashboard to its default view.
